New Company Rating Tool on ClassADrivers.com
 
We have put together a new tool that allows drivers to give ratings for companies based on 6 different criteria.

The only way a company can be rated is by a driver who signs up to use our application service at https://www.classadrivers.com/driverapplication.php

Once a driver establishes an application account (which is free of course) they will have access to an area from each companies profile sheet where they can rate them on a scale from 1 to 5 (5 being the best) on six different criteria;

1. Company Benefits
2. Pay
3. Home Time
4. Mileage
5. Equipment
6. Respect For Drivers

Drivers who have previously established an application service with us can use this tool as well, they will just need to use their application log in information to acces the rating sheets.

Roehl as a company
 
To me roehl as a company is great if your used to a big company running every aspect of what your doing, by that i mean they monitor every single thing you do, overspeed (over 67) since they consider that totally unsafe, they expect you to slow down to a crawl while driving through a city and possibly get run over by everyone behind you.

for the national fleet you spend alot of time picking up and relaying loads for the 7 on 7 off fleet so they can just get under load and take off with a long run while you spend time running 300 mile runs trying to make as many miles as you can before friday just to find out they are putting you under a long run that delivers monday on thursday so you are stuck with probably 1500-2000 miles for the week.

they also treat all their drivers like they went to the Roehl driving academy in such that every little thing thats off on your logs you will recive a phone call about such as tarping loads getting loaded as they have macros on the 'puter they want you to send in so they can verify that on your logs as well.

And as far as if you decide on quitting Roehl well i have a few freinds that have done that and what they will do is get you to a yd tell you to get your stuff out and you no longer work for roehl and tell you to get off property, and one i know of that lives a mile from me(in NC) was giving a load to CA and told to drop ld on YD on Fontana CA, once he got there they told him he can go ahead and clean his truck out there since they have somebody needing a truck there, that by far is not the way to treat drivers by any means, i think if a driver just feels he needs to move on and find something better and has not done anything wrong to the company they should at least get him home thats just my opinion of that since basically im about to quit Roehl and move to TMC in may and dont want to end up the same way that these drivers have :idea:
